Conversational French FAQ

What are the basics of conversational French for beginners?

The basics of conversational French for beginners include greetings such as 'Bonjour' (Hello), 'Salut' (Hi), and 'Comment ça va?' (How are you?). It's also essential to learn common phrases like 'S'il vous plaît' (Please), 'Merci' (Thank you), and 'Excusez-moi' (Excuse me). Numbers, days of the week, and simple sentence construction are fundamental, as well as polite conversation enders like 'Au revoir' (Goodbye) and 'Bonne journée' (Have a good day).

How can I practice conversational French fluently?

To practice conversational French fluently, engage in regular speaking exercises with a native French speaker or a tutor. Utilize language exchange platforms, enroll in French conversation classes, or join French-speaking groups. Additionally, immerse yourself in the language by watching French movies, listening to French music, and using language learning apps designed for conversational practice. Consistency and practical application of language skills in real-life situations contribute to fluency.

What are common French conversation topics for a tutoring session?

Common French conversation topics for a tutoring session include discussing personal interests such as hobbies, movies, and music, as well as daily routines and family. Cultural topics like French cuisine, holidays, and traditions are engaging, along with travel experiences and plans. Current events and weather are also practical and frequent subjects to enrich the vocabulary and conversational skills.

Are there specific phrases I should learn for conversational French?

Yes, there are specific phrases essential for conversational French: polite expressions like 'Je vous en prie' (You're welcome), 'Pouvez-vous m'aider?' (Can you help me?), questions such as 'Où est la salle de bain?' (Where is the bathroom?), and responses like 'Je pense que...' (I think that...). Learning these phrases can help you navigate various everyday situations and converse more naturally with French speakers.

What are the best resources for learning conversational French?

The best resources for learning conversational French include online courses, language learning apps (like Duolingo or Babbel), French podcasts, and YouTube channels focused on French learning. French conversation groups or meetups can provide practical speaking opportunities. Books, movies, and media in French can aid in understanding context and nuances. Lastly, consider hiring a tutor for personalized guidance and feedback.

MAPLEWOOD, NJ Neighborhoods We Service

Nestled in the southern part of Essex County, Maplewood, NJ, is a picturesque township known for its quaint neighborhoods, rich history, and vibrant community. Each distinct neighborhood in Maplewood contributes to the town's unique charm and character, offering residents a sense of place and a variety of living experiences. In this article, we'll take a closer look at all the neighborhoods in Maplewood, NJ, highlighting what makes each one special.

First on our list is the Maplewood Village area, the heart and soul of the township. This downtown district buzzes with activity, lined with charming boutiques, delightful eateries, and the historic Maplewood Theater. The neighborhood embodies an old-world feel with its cozy atmosphere and pedestrian-friendly streets, transporting residents and visitors alike to a place where community spirit thrives.

Next, we have the Memorial Park neighborhood, which surrounds the picturesque park after which it is named. This area is characterized by stately homes that overlook the well-maintained parkland. With playgrounds, sports facilities, and scenic picnic spots, the Memorial Park neighborhood is a favorite among families looking for ample recreational opportunities.

College Hill, another popular neighborhood, lies close to the Maplewood/South Orange border. It's known for its academic influence, given the proximity to Seton Hall University. College Hill is a melting pot of students, faculty, and families who enjoy a scholarly environment with a residential twist.

The Jefferson neighborhood, found at the western edge of Maplewood, enjoys a more secluded and suburban feel. Boasting larger lots and a variety of architectural styles from different eras, Jefferson offers tranquility while still maintaining easy access to major thoroughfares and transport options.

De Hart Park area, adjacent to the park itself, provides both quiet residential streets and active sporting fields. With its community pool and verdant spaces, it's where the outdoors is always just a few steps away. The De Hart Park neighborhood represents Maplewood's commitment to maintaining green spaces and fostering an active lifestyle.

The Hilton neighborhood, on the north side of Maplewood, is a diverse and dynamic area known for its strong sense of community. Here, you'll find a mix of housing options suitable for all, from apartments and condos to single-family homes. The tight-knit Hilton neighborhood is the site of the annual Maplewood Jazz Festival, adding a touch of musicality to the area's vibrant culture.

Golf Island, an enclave that's quaint and lesser-known, is tucked between the Maplewood Country Club's golf course and the West Branch of the Rahway River. The neighborhood's name pays homage to its picturesque surroundings, and it's a haven for those seeking peace and privacy.

Finally, the Wyoming neighborhood, with its rolling landscapes and historic homes, exudes an old-town elegance. The beautiful Wyoming School, with its storied past, serves as a focal point, and Littell's Pond adds a touch of natural beauty to the area. The Wyoming section is known for its tight-knit community and active neighborhood association, making it a desired location for many.

Maplewood, NJ, is a community that truly offers something for everyone. From the bustling village life in the center of town to the quiet, leafy outskirts, each neighborhood plays a vital role in creating the vibrant tapestry that is Maplewood. Whether one seeks the nightlife and convenience of urban living, or the tranquility of a suburban retreat, they can find their perfect spot within the welcoming borders of this beloved township.

About MAPLEWOOD, NJ And It’s Education Institutions

Nestled in Essex County, Maplewood, New Jersey, is a picturesque suburb with a rich history and vibrant community. Founded as part of South Orange Township in 1861, it officially became its independent municipality in 1922, adopting the name Maplewood for the abundant maple trees in the area. In its early days, Maplewood was primarily rural, slowly evolving into a suburban idyll as transportation to New York City improved. Today, the township is known for its diverse and welcoming atmosphere, and as of the most recent estimates, it proudly supports a population of roughly 25,000 residents. Key landmarks that capture the essence of Maplewood include the iconic Maplewood Station, which adds to the charm of the village with its cozy shops and eateries, and the historical Durand-Hedden House and Garden, which provides a glimpse into the area's past.

Education figures prominently in Maplewood's community focus, with a strong commitment seen through various education institutions and resources available to students. Notably, the Maplewood-South Orange School District (SOMSD), which operates several highly praised schools. Top-ranking public K-12 schools such as Columbia High School and Maplewood Middle School offer students a comprehensive education experience. Various private schools are also available for families seeking alternative educational environments. Furthermore, while there are no universities within the Maplewood boundaries, residents have easy access to numerous higher education establishments in the surrounding regions, ensuring that all levels of learning are well-catered to.

Residents and families of Maplewood benefit from a wealth of education resources, including multiple public libraries well-stocked with learning materials and programming for students of all ages. The town's educational commitment is clear in its support for special, gifted, and varied extracurricular programs alongside events designed to further knowledge and community engagement. Additionally, various local organizations and parent-teacher associations contribute significantly to creating a nurturing and stimulating educational environment. Though Maplewood itself may not host a university, Seton Hall University lies in close proximity, providing opportunities for continuing education and community partnerships. This civic dedication to learning makes Maplewood not just a place to live, but a place to grow intellectually and culturally.

About Conversational French & Conversational French Tutoring

Le français conversationnel est une forme du français utilisée dans la communication de tous les jours. Contrairement au français formel qui est souvent trouvé dans la littérature écrite, le discours officiel, ou les transactions professionnelles, le français conversationnel est informel et utilisé dans des contextes décontractés parmi les amis, la famille, et lors de rencontres sociales.

Ce type de français est caractérisé par l'utilisation de tournures de phrases plus simples, des expressions idiomatiques, du jargon, et des abréviations. Il inclut également des mots de remplissage, des hésitations et des adaptations régionales qui reflètent la diversité de la langue parlée. Il existe plusieurs types de français conversationnel, y compris le français familier, l'argot français (slang), et le verlan, qui est une forme d'argot où l'ordre des syllabes dans les mots est inversé.

Les entités liées au français conversationnel comprennent la phonétique, qui est cruciale pour la prononciation correcte, la grammaire appliquée à la langue parlée, et la pragmatique, l'étude de la manière dont le contexte contribue au sens. Cela peut également inclure la sociolinguistique, qui étudie comment le français varie en fonction des classes sociales, des régions et d'autres facteurs sociaux.

La meilleure stratégie pour enseigner le français conversationnel à quelqu'un qui a des difficultés avec le sujet est une immersion partielle ou totale. Cela peut inclure des conversations régulières avec des locuteurs natifs, la participation à des groupes de discussion, ou l'utilisation d'applications de langue qui se concentrent sur la langue parlée. Les tuteurs devraient encourager les apprenants à écouter activement et à répéter ce qu'ils entendent, en mettant en place un environnement où il est sûr de faire des erreurs et d'apprendre de celles-ci.

Les concepts les plus courants en français conversationnel sont les salutations ("Bonjour", "Comment ça va ?"), les formules de politesse ("S'il vous plaît", "Merci"), et les phrases utilisées quotidiennement pour exprimer des besoins ou des opinions simples. Les concepts les plus difficiles peuvent inclure l'utilisation correcte des temps verbaux en conversation, l'accord du participe passé, l'emploi des pronoms objets (comme "le", "la", "les") et des pronoms relatifs ("qui", "que", "dont"), ainsi que l'adaptation aux nuances et aux sous-entendus des expressions idiomatiques et des argots.

Apprendre le français conversationnel exige de la patience et de la pratique, mais c'est aussi une expérience enrichissante qui ouvre les portes à une riche culture francophone.
